Shala Membership
At Rudra Yogshala, we honour personal sadhana as a vital part of the yogic path.
​
Shala Membership is open to experienced practitioners who wish to practice independently in a quiet, shared space. During these hours, guided classes may be in session, and practitioners are welcome to practice alongside with awareness and respect for the collective container.
​
This offering is for those comfortable practicing without verbal instruction and who value discipline, silence, and mutual respect.
Approval may be required to maintain the integrity of the space.

Shala Etiquette
-
Our shala is a shared space for practice and presence. These guidelines help maintain stillness, respect, and collective harmony.​
-
Enter and exit quietly and mindfully, allowing others to remain undisturbed in their practice.
-
Keep phones on silent and stored away during practice. This is a space to turn inward.
-
Place shoes, bags, and personal belongings in designated areas.
-
​Guided classes and Mysore-style self-practice may take place together. Please move with awareness of the shared space.
-
​Self-practice is intended for experienced practitioners comfortable practicing independently. Teachers may be present to hold space but may not always guide.
-
Practice with awareness of your body and breath. This is not a space for performance or force.
-
Hands-on adjustments are offered only by teachers and only with consent. Students are requested not to adjust or correct others.
-
​Please care for the shala — return props neatly, wipe down mats, and treat the space with respect.
-
Wear comfortable, modest clothing, preferably cotton, that supports ease of movement.
-
​The shala is a space for sadhana. Conversations and socialising may continue outside the practice area.
-
Rudra Yogshala reserves the right to review or withdraw shala access if the integrity of the space is compromised.
-
These are gentle reminders — to practice with presence, humility, and respect for the shared journey.
